Sustainable Technologies and the Green Revolution
Now, let's shift gears to a topic that's more important than ever: sustainability. By 2025, we'll see a massive push towards green technologies and sustainable practices. The urgency to address climate change will drive innovation in renewable energy sources, like solar, wind, and geothermal, which will become more efficient and affordable. We can also expect to see significant advancements in energy storage solutions, such as batteries, that will help overcome the intermittency of renewable energy sources. This will create a more reliable and sustainable energy grid. The transition to electric vehicles (EVs) will accelerate. Improvements in battery technology and charging infrastructure will make EVs more appealing to consumers, leading to a reduction in greenhouse gas emissions from the transportation sector. Beyond energy, expect to see innovations in other areas like sustainable agriculture and waste management. Precision farming techniques will optimize crop yields while minimizing the use of water, fertilizers, and pesticides. Circular economy models will gain traction, focusing on reducing waste, reusing materials, and recycling resources. Companies and governments will be investing heavily in sustainable solutions, creating new job opportunities and business ventures. Biotechnology and Personalized Healthcare
Now let's turn to the world of health and wellness. Biotechnology and personalized healthcare are on the rise, and they're set to transform the way we approach healthcare by 2025. We're talking about advanced genetic technologies, such as gene editing and personalized medicine, that will revolutionize disease prevention, diagnosis, and treatment. Expect to see more advanced gene editing tools, like CRISPR, being used to correct genetic defects and treat diseases at the root. Personalized medicine will become more commonplace, with treatments tailored to an individual's genetic makeup, lifestyle, and environment. This will lead to more effective and targeted therapies, reducing side effects and improving patient outcomes. Digital health technologies, such as wearable devices and remote patient monitoring, will play a bigger role in healthcare. These technologies will enable real-time monitoring of vital signs, early detection of health problems, and personalized health recommendations.
